Enum Expr

Source
pub enum Expr {
Show 15 variants Ref(Loc, Target), Word(Loc, Option<Width>, u64), Enum(Loc, Type, String), Struct(Loc, Vec<(String, Box<Expr>)>), Vec(Loc, Vec<Expr>), Call(Loc, String, Vec<Expr>), Let(Loc, String,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>), UnOp(Loc, UnOp, Box<Expr>), BinOp(Loc, BinOp,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>), If(Loc,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>), Match(Loc, Box<Expr>, Vec<MatchArm>), IdxField(Loc, Box<Expr>, String), Idx(Loc, Box<Expr>, u64), IdxRange(Loc, Box<Expr>, u64, u64), Hole(Loc, Option<String>),
}
Expand description

An expression.

Variants§

§

Ref(Loc, Target)

A referenec to a port, reg, or node.

§

Word(Loc, Option<Width>, u64)

A literal Word.

§

Enum(Loc, Type, String)

A literal enum value.

§

Struct(Loc, Vec<(String, Box<Expr>)>)

A constructor for a struct type.

§

Vec(Loc, Vec<Expr>)

A constructor for a Vec

§

Call(Loc, String, Vec<Expr>)

A call-like expression, including cat and constructors like @Valid.

§

Let(Loc, String,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>)

Let binding. Eg, let x = a + b in x + x.

§

UnOp(Loc, UnOp, Box<Expr>)

A unary operation. Eg, !0b101w3.

§

BinOp(Loc, BinOp,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>)

A binary operation. Eg, 1w8 + 1w8.

§

If(Loc,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>, Box<Expr>)

An if expression.

§

Match(Loc, Box<Expr>, Vec<MatchArm>)

A match expression.

§

IdxField(Loc, Box<Expr>, String)

A field index. Eg, foo->bar.

§

Idx(Loc, Box<Expr>, u64)

A static index. Eg, foo[0].

§

IdxRange(Loc, Box<Expr>, u64, u64)

A static index over a range. Eg, foo[8..4].

§

Hole(Loc, Option<String>)

A hole. Eg, ?foo.
